对象存储服务都有些什么功能?,揭秘对象存储服务,功能与应用解析
- 综合资讯
- 2024-11-28 12:30:10
- 1

对象存储服务主要功能包括:存储和管理大量非结构化数据、支持数据备份和恢复、提供高可用性和弹性扩展。应用场景涵盖云存储、大数据分析、视频点播等领域,助力企业实现数据安全、...
对象存储服务主要功能包括:存储和管理大量非结构化数据、支持数据备份和恢复、提供高可用性和弹性扩展。应用场景涵盖云存储、大数据分析、视频点播等领域,助力企业实现数据安全、高效管理。
随着互联网的飞速发展,数据量呈爆炸式增长,传统的存储方式已无法满足需求,对象存储服务(Object Storage Service)作为一种新型存储方式,以其高效、安全、可扩展等特点,受到了广泛关注,本文将详细介绍对象存储服务的功能与应用,帮助读者全面了解这一技术。
对象存储服务概述
1、定义
对象存储服务是一种基于对象模型的存储服务,它将数据以对象的形式存储,每个对象包含数据本身、元数据以及存储位置信息,与传统的文件存储和块存储相比,对象存储具有以下特点:
(1)按需扩展:对象存储支持水平扩展,可轻松应对海量数据的存储需求。
(2)高可靠性:对象存储采用冗余存储机制,确保数据的安全性和可靠性。
(3)易于访问:对象存储支持多种访问方式,如HTTP、RESTful API等,方便用户进行数据操作。
(4)灵活的元数据:对象存储允许用户为每个对象添加自定义的元数据,方便数据管理和检索。
2、应用场景
对象存储服务适用于以下场景:
(1)海量数据存储:如云盘、云存储、大数据平台等。
分发网络(CDN):提供高速、稳定的图片、视频等媒体内容分发。
(3)数据备份与归档:保障数据安全,降低存储成本。
(4)分布式存储系统:构建可扩展、高可靠的分布式存储平台。
对象存储服务功能
1、存储空间管理
对象存储服务提供以下存储空间管理功能:
(1)创建存储空间:用户可根据需求创建自定义的存储空间。
(2)命名空间:存储空间内的对象命名遵循统一命名规则。
(3)权限管理:设置对象访问权限,保障数据安全。
(4)生命周期管理:设置对象的生命周期,自动执行删除、归档等操作。
2、数据管理
对象存储服务提供以下数据管理功能:
(1)对象上传下载:支持断点续传,提高数据传输效率。
(2)对象列表:查看存储空间内所有对象的详细信息。
(3)对象复制:实现对象在不同存储空间之间的复制。
(4)对象元数据管理:为对象添加、修改、删除元数据。
3、访问控制
对象存储服务提供以下访问控制功能:
(1)权限控制:设置对象访问权限,包括读、写、删除等。
(2)IP白名单:限制特定IP地址访问对象。
(3)API密钥:通过API密钥进行身份验证和授权。
4、监控与审计
对象存储服务提供以下监控与审计功能:
(1)存储空间监控:实时监控存储空间的使用情况。
(2)对象访问日志:记录对象访问记录,方便审计。
(3)性能监控:监控对象存储服务的性能指标,如延迟、吞吐量等。
5、高可用与容灾
对象存储服务提供以下高可用与容灾功能:
(1)多地域部署:将数据分布在多个地域,提高数据可靠性。
(2)自动故障转移:当某个地域发生故障时,自动将数据转移到其他地域。
(3)数据备份:定期备份数据,降低数据丢失风险。
对象存储服务应用案例
1、云盘
对象存储服务作为云盘的核心存储技术,提供海量存储空间,支持文件上传、下载、分享等功能,用户可通过客户端或Web端访问云盘,实现数据同步和备份。
2、CDN
对象存储服务与CDN相结合,为用户提供高速、稳定的图片、视频等媒体内容分发,通过将热点内容存储在对象存储服务中,CDN可快速响应用户请求,提高用户体验。
3、数据备份与归档
对象存储服务可作为企业数据备份与归档的解决方案,保障数据安全,通过定期备份和归档,降低数据丢失风险,提高数据可靠性。
4、分布式存储系统
对象存储服务可构建可扩展、高可靠的分布式存储平台,满足企业海量数据存储需求,通过分布式存储技术,提高数据读写性能,降低存储成本。
对象存储服务作为一种新型存储方式,具有高效、安全、可扩展等特点,在云计算、大数据等领域得到了广泛应用,本文从定义、功能、应用场景等方面对对象存储服务进行了详细介绍,希望对读者有所帮助,随着技术的不断发展,对象存储服务将在更多领域发挥重要作用。
本文链接:https://zhitaoyun.cn/1148752.html
发表评论